Laboratory Services Assistant Manager

GENERAL SUMMARY :

The Laboratory Services Assistant Manager manages laboratory services resources and coordinates the activities of personnel engaged in performing phlebotomy and data control functions. Maintains quality control of processes and product inventory used in phlebotomy and data control. Promotes retention of staff through recognition and promotion of teamwork. Promotes and encourages professional development of laboratory staff. Assures optimal patient care standards through daily interaction and role modeling. Supports and facilitates a respectful and collaborative relationship between medical staff, hospital staff, and laboratory staff.

    REQUIRED K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ES :

    1. Knowledge of clinical phlebotomy methods and procedures.

    2. Knowledge of quality improvement tools and processes.

    3. Knowledge of computer hardware equipment and software applications relevant to work functions.

    4. Ability to schedule, direct, counsel and evaluate employee work and performance.

    5. Ability to problem-solve and make decisions in accordance with facility protocols and regulatory agency requirements.

    6. Ability to communicate effectively both verbally and in writing.

    7. Ability to read, interpret and enforce departmental safety rules, equipment operating and maintenance requirements and policy and procedures.

    8. Ability to provide on-the-job training in laboratory sample collection.

    9. Ability to develop written policies and procedures, memoranda and performance evaluations with measurable behaviors.

    10. Ability to balance and prioritize diverse management and clinical responsibilities.

    11.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with all levels of personnel, medical staff, volunteer and ancillary departments including diverse patient populations.

    E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E :

    Associate's degree (AA) or two (2) years progress toward a Bachelor of Science degree in health care related field of study required; Bachelor of Science degree is preferred. Minimum two (2) years experience as a phlebotomist required.

    OTHER CREDENTIALS / CERTIFICATIONS :

    (PBT) Certification for Phlebotomy Technician by the American Society for Clinical Pathology or equivalent certification preferred.

    P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S :

    (Physical Requirements are based on federal criteria and assigned by Human Resources upon review of the Principal Job Functions.)

    (DOT) – Characterized as light work requiring exertion up to 20 pounds of force occasionally, and / or up to 10 pounds of force frequently, and / or a negligible amount of force constantly to move objects.

    Must be able to distinguish and discriminate between colors.
